If your body is healthy, your hair will be healthy too. Practice smart hair care by following a sound diet plan that includes nutrient-rich food and abundant hydration. Eating a balanced diet that includes plenty of whole grains, fruits and vegetables, lean protein and beneficial fats can help your hair stay healthy and strong.
Avoid brushing your hair when it is wet. Wet hair is delicate and easily breaks when brushed. To minimize damage, either brush your hair before you shower, or wait until after it has had time to dry before combing it out.

Blow Dryer
If you use a blow dryer to style your hair, move the blow dryer around continuously so that no one part of your head is exposed to the heat for too long. That way, serious damage resulting from heat can be prevented.
Alcohol is an ingredient found in some hair care products. It can harm your hair by drying it out. They’re not good for your hair and you need to watch what products you put into your hair anyway. Check the labels of any hair care products you are considering to ensure that they do not contain alcohol.
If you frequently swim, wet your hair prior to getting in the pool. This will prevent too much chlorine from getting into your hair. Also, if you swim sans a swim cap, wash your hair right after swimming to stave off any chlorine damage.
When you brush your hair, begin at the ends and work upward. Detangle your hair carefully as you work through your hair to minimize breakage. Once the knots are worked out, use long strokes, starting at the roots of your hair and proceeding all the way down to the tips.
When you shampoo your hair, you should avoid using products that will strip it of its oils. Even if your hair is oily, a harsh shampoo which gets rid of all oil can create a rebound effect where your hair produces too much oil. Rather, you should use the mildest shampoo that can clean your hair. There are people out there that only use conditioner to wash their hair, and do so only once every few days.
